One of Vauxhall's jewels

Tucked away, just five minutes from the the Royal Vauxhall Tavern, the Eagle and the rest, you'll find this corner café-shop that sells not only Italian specialties — including high-quality provisions and expert espressos using Monmouth coffee — but food items (proper fruit and veg, jams etc) and home-made savouries, including well-stuffed sandwiches.
